Hvordan krypterer jeg en tabel i mysql?
Hvordan krypterer jeg en tabel i mysql?

Video: Hvordan krypterer jeg en tabel i mysql?

Video: Hvordan krypterer jeg en tabel i mysql?
Video: Как установить MySQL в Windows 10 2024, November
Anonim

At begynde kryptering det borde , bliver vi nødt til at køre alter bord tabelnavn kryptering ='Y', som MySQL vil ikke kryptere tabeller som standard. Den seneste Percona Xtrabackup understøtter også kryptering , og kan sikkerhedskopiere krypterede tabeller . Du kan også bruge denne forespørgsel i stedet: vælg * fra informationsskema.

I betragtning af dette, er MySQL-databasen krypteret?

Er MySQL database filer, der er gemt på disken krypteret ? Ingen. MySQL ikke som standard kryptere dens filer. Du er ikke klar over hvilken slags data du er kryptering , men det ser ud til, at den bedste løsning i dit tilfælde ville være en kolonnebaseret kryptering løsning.

På samme måde, hvilken kryptering bruger MySQL til adgangskoder? AES_ENCRYPT() og AES_DECRYPT() anses for at være de mest kryptografisk sikre kryptering funktioner, der i øjeblikket er tilgængelige i MySQL . Bemærk, at SHA-2-, DES- og AES-funktionerne kræver MySQL skal konfigureres med SSL-understøttelse.

Bare så, skal du kryptere din database?

Ingen, du sandsynligvis bør ikke kryptere dataene . Du måske også vil kryptere database sikkerhedskopier. Og fysisk sikker det værelse det serveren er placeret i.

Hvor meget koster MySQL?

MySQL Standardudgave (web og slutbrugere) til $2000,0 om året. MySQL Enterprise Edition (web- og slutbrugere) til $5000,0 om året. MySQL Cluster Carrier Grade Edition (web- og slutbrugere) til $10000,0 om året.

Anbefalede: